Why does the Rough Endoplasmic Reticulum look 'rough' under a microscope?
A.Due to the presence of ribosomes on its surface✓ Correct

Explanation
The Rough Endoplasmic Reticulum (RER) appears 'rough' under the microscope due to the presence of ribosomes attached to its outer surface (cytoplasmic side). These ribosomes give it a granular or studded appearance. The ribosomes attached to RER are involved in the synthesis of proteins, particularly those destined for secretion, membrane insertion, or transport to other organelles. In contrast, the Smooth Endoplasmic Reticulum (SER) lacks ribosomes and appears smooth; it is involved in lipid synthesis, detoxification, and calcium storage. Lysosomes and mitochondria are separate organelles and are not present on the ER surface.
